How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lindenhurst?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Lindenhurst Pet Friendly Studio Apartments | $2,275 | $1,500 | $2,595 |
Lindenhurst Pet Friendly 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,527 | $1,700 | $5,399 |
Lindenhurst Pet Friendly 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,165 | $1,800 | $5,949 |
Lindenhurst Pet Friendly 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,534 | $3,000 | $4,795 |
Lindenhurst Pet Friendly 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,500 | $4,500 | $4,500 |

Cheapest Pet Friendly Apartment Rentals in Lindenhurst, NY
The lowest priced Lindenhurst apartment at a property that allows pets is the Studio Upper Studio Model at Fairfield Maples North in the West Side neighborhood starting from $1,940. The second cheapest Lindenhurst Pet Friendly apartment is the 1 Bedroom, 1 Bath 580 sq. ft. Model at Holiday Square - 55 And Above, which is a 1 Bed starting at $1,950 in the Presidential Section neighborhood. Here are the most affordable Pet Friendly Lindenhurst apartments.
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
---|---|---|
Fairfield Maples North | Studio Upper | $1,940 |
Holiday Square - 55 And Above | 1 Bedroom, 1 Bath 580 sq. ft. | $1,950 |
Fairfield Maples South | The Birch Upper | $2,015 |
Fairfield Court | The Shelton Lower | $2,115 |
Fairfield Suburbia Gardens | The Village Upper | $2,150 |
The Niche at Calvert Gardens | 1 Bed, 1 bath | $2,300 |
The Harbour Club | 1A - One Bedroom Electric First Floor | $2,520 |
Fairfield At West Babylon | The Sunset Upper | $2,530 |
Fairfield Oaks | The Sierra Lower | $2,565 |
Fairfield Townhouses At West Babylon | Residence 106 | $3,315 |
